Humza Yousaf is a dedicated public servant and a trailblazer in civic engagement, known for his tireless work in advancing equity, justice, and representation. His list of accomplishments include achievements that reflect his commitment to the values we share here at MPAC. In 2023, he became leader of the Scottish National Party and the first person of color and first Muslim to serve as First Minister of Scotland, as well as being the second Muslim to lead a major British political party. From 2018-2021, he served as justice secretary in Scotland, where he introduced the Hate Crime and Public Order Bill. This bill was significant in expanding protections against hate speech.

Throughout his career, Yousaf has broken many barriers while navigating complex issues in health, justice, and social care. MPAC is proud to recognize Yousaf for his leadership, integrity, and vision of a more inclusive America where every person has the opportunity to serve and thrive.
